Summary
If you make 14 016 kr a year living in the region of Stockholm, Sweden, you will be taxed 7.05 kr. That means that your net pay will be 14 009 kr per year, or 1 167 kr per month. Your average tax rate is 0.1% and your marginal tax rate is 2.3%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 kr in your salary will be taxed 2.26 kr, hence, your net pay will only increase by 97.74 kr.
Bonus Example
A 1 000 kr bonus will generate an extra 977 kr of net incomes. A 5 000 kr bonus will generate an extra 4 887 kr of net incomes.
